Hey all, having some weird tonemapping issues that I can't figure out even with a lot of googling.
Tonemapping seems to work initially on HDR content, but after a couple of seconds (it differs how long but always happens within seconds) the image seems to gray out/gets washed out. Each time I restart the video, I get the same experience - a few seconds of it working and then it gets washed out.
If I pause the video before it washes out, and change the tonemapping settings - it reflects it. But it seemingly gets disabled a few seconds after I unpause it.
